Naveran Brut Cava 2018, 
750ml, $16.99
From vines planted on clay and limestone around the village of Sant Sadurni d’Anoia, this is a classic blend of 50 percent xarel-lo, 40 percent macabeo, with parellada making up the rest. It aged for 18 months on its lees and developed slight hints of flor, as if it were a bubbly interpretation of a Fino. It moves through the mouth in cool waves of flavor, the texture firm yet creamy. It’s a rich, layered sparkler to serve with suquet de peix, a classic Catalàn fish soup with clams.
